impact of volcanic gases on acid rain formation
which of the following gases released during a volcanic eruption contributes most significantly to the formation of acid rain, impacting the hydrosphere?
a oxygen
b carbon dioxide
c sulfur dioxide
d nitrogen
Brief Explanations
Sulfur - dioxide released during volcanic eruptions reacts with water vapor in the atmosphere to form sulfuric - acid, which is a major contributor to acid rain. Oxygen, carbon - dioxide, and nitrogen do not contribute as significantly to acid - rain formation from volcanic gases.
